Detection & response playbook

Malicious package
  1. Find it

    Scan your lockfiles (package-lock.json, pnpm-lock.yaml, yarn.lock, requirements.txt, poetry.lock, etc.) and build artifacts for zzlambcalx1778552149 (version 0.0.1). O3 Security's supply-chain scanner checks every dependency against known-malicious package intelligence at install time and in CI, flagging zzlambcalx1778552149 across your stack and pipelines.

  2. If you installed it — respond

    Remove zzlambcalx1778552149 from your project and lockfile, then assume any secrets accessible to the build or runtime were exposed: rotate API keys, tokens, and credentials, and audit for unexpected outbound activity or persistence.

  3. Did it already run?

    If zzlambcalx1778552149 was ever installed, its post-install/runtime payload may have already executed.
